An ephah, three bushels of meal, for each ram.



As he shall be able to give; rather, as he shall see good, as much as he thinks fit in decency or in bounty.



An hin; one gallon and a pint, for an hin did contain twelve logs, and each log contained three quarters of a pint, or thereabouts.



To an ephah; which was three times eight gallons, for each ephah contained three bushels: see Eze_46:11. So then one gallon and one pint of oil was required as proportion to three bushels of meal in the meat-offering.
